Women of Legal Tech: Anna McGrane

Meet Anna McGrane, COO at PacerPro, whose legal career shifted when her brother asked her to fly to Texas for a conference, instead of going back to Beijing. The rest, as it goes, is history (at least so far.)

McGrane is the latest profile for the “Women of Legal Tech” series at Legaltech news. (Disclaimer: I compile the series.)

McGrane has unusual advice for young women: “Don’t pay too much attention to titles (yours or other people’s). Focus on opportunities where you are contributing to something that matters to you.”

She says she sometimes misses her law firm experience, but is leaving the future wide open.

“There are many days when I miss the predictability of the law firm trackā€”of knowing where I’d be and what I’d be doing. But the reality is, the things I have loved most in my life came from opportunities that arose along the way. What’s important is just that I still be doing work that I enjoy for an organization that cares about doing what’s right.”
